A distributed task reassignment method in dynamic environment for multi-UAV system

Mi Yang, Wenhao Bi, An Zhang, Fei Gao

Research output: Contribution to journalArticlepeer-review

34 Scopus citations

Abstract

This paper considers the task reassignment problem for distributed multiple Unmanned Aerial Vehicle (multi-UAV) systems in dynamic environment. For a dynamic reassignment problem in a multi-UAV system, the task information may be subject to different dynamic events, and many existing task allocation algorithms require much computation and communication resource to achieve a feasible solution. Hence, this paper proposes a distributed method to cope with dynamic events that occur online during the execution of original schedules. First, a distributed framework for determining the processing strategy according to the types of dynamic events is introduced. Second, a partial reassignment algorithm (PRA) is proposed to support the framework and an incremental subteam formation mechanism and a partial releasing mechanism are developed to release the computation and communication burden. Furthermore, a modified inclusion phase to maximize assignment (MIP-MA) is also proposed in PRA to maximize the number of task allocations. Numerical simulations demonstrate that the proposed method is able to provide a conflict-free solution with less data exchanges and runtime.

Original languageEnglish
Pages (from-to)1582-1601
Number of pages20
JournalApplied Intelligence
Volume52
Issue number2
DOIs
StatePublished - Jan 2022

Keywords

  • Distributed task allocation
  • Dynamic environment
  • Heuristic algorithm
  • Multi-UAV system

Fingerprint

Dive into the research topics of 'A distributed task reassignment method in dynamic environment for multi-UAV system'. Together they form a unique fingerprint.

Cite this